Course Description
Prerequisite: Minimum grade of C in ENGL 115, ENGL 103W, ENGL 103, or ENGL 104, or English placement test score (Level 2 or higher ). Concurrent enrollment in ENGL 115 allowed. An introduction to the fields of women's and gender studies. Emphases include the representation of women and the LGBTQ+ community in fine arts, pop culture, athletics, and the entertainment media. A global and multicultural perspective is used to discuss issues of representation in the humanities as well as how the humanities are used as educational and activist tools.[Semester Offered: Spring]
